Identification
Molecular formula
C4H9NO
CAS number
96-29-7
IUPAC name
butan-2-one oxime
State
State
At room temperature, butanone oxime is a liquid. It has a relatively low melting point which keeps it in liquid state under normal conditions.
Melting point (Celsius)
-29.00
Melting point (Kelvin)
244.15
Boiling point (Celsius)
152.80
Boiling point (Kelvin)
425.95
General information
Molecular weight
73.12g/mol
Molar mass
73.1200g/mol
Density
0.9235g/cm3
Appearence

Butanone oxime is a colorless to slightly yellow liquid. It is known for its strong sweet pungent odor and is often used in industrial applications. The liquid is volatile and can form vapors that may contribute to its recognizable scent.

Comment on solubility

Solubility of Butan-2-one Oxime

Butan-2-one oxime, with the chemical formula C4H9NO, exhibits unique solubility characteristics that are influenced by its structure and functional groups. Here are several key points regarding its solubility:

  • Solvent Interaction: Butan-2-one oxime is generally soluble in polar solvents such as water, due to its ability to engage in hydrogen bonding.
  • Organic Solvents: It is also soluble in common organic solvents like ethanol and ether, making it versatile for various applications.
  • Temperature Dependency: The solubility can increase with temperature; thus, heating the solvent may enhance dissolution rates.
  • Concentration Factor: While butan-2-one oxime is relatively soluble, saturation limits can vary depending on the solvent system employed.

The molecular structure of butan-2-one oxime contains both hydrophilic (the hydroxyl group) and hydrophobic (the alkyl chain) parts, which contributes to its dual nature in solubility. In essence, “the solubility of butan-2-one oxime reflects a balance between its polar and non-polar characteristics,” allowing it to be used effectively in various chemical processes.


Interesting facts

Interesting Facts About Butan-2-one Oxime

Butan-2-one oxime, commonly referred to as methyl ethyl ketoxime, presents a fascinating blend of properties that make it noteworthy for a variety of chemical applications.

Key Insights:

  • Industrial Relevance: Butan-2-one oxime is primarily utilized as an intermediate in the synthesis of various chemicals and is a key component in the production of hydroxylamine derivatives.
  • Role in Coatings: This compound is often employed as a reactive diluent in the formulation of paints and coatings, promoting adhesion and enhancing durability.
  • Health and Safety Considerations: As with many chemical compounds, it is crucial to handle butan-2-one oxime with care. Proper safety measures should be taken, including the use of personal protective equipment (PPE) due to its potential health hazards.
  • Research Potential: This oxime has become a subject of interest in research, particularly in the study of organic synthesis and its application in creating more complex molecular structures.
